A. WHAT IS PHILOSOPHY?

1. What is the etymology of the word “philosophy”?


- The original meaning of the word philosophy comes from the Greek roots philo-
meaning "love" and -sophos, or "wisdom." When someone studies philosophy they
want to understand how and why people do certain things and how to live a good
life.
2. What is the historical definition of philosophy?
- It is the study of general and fundamental questions, such as those about existence,
reason, knowledge, values, mind, and language.
3. What is the essential definition of Philosophy?
- The study of ideas about knowledge, truth, the nature and meaning of life, etc.
4. What is the technical or lexical definition of Philosophy?
- Technical - Philosophy (from Greek: φιλοσοφία, philosophia, 'love of wisdom') is the
study of general and fundamental questions, such as those about existence, reason,
knowledge, values, mind, and language.
